ABSTRACT:
A ceramic having non-linear voltage characteristics, comprising the product obtained on mixing (a) zinc oxide, as a principal component, and (b) (1) cobalt and (2) one of neodymium, samarium or dysprosium, either in an elemental form or as a compound thereof, each in an amount of 0.1 to 10 atomic % for the cobalt, neodymium, samarium and dysprosium, calculated as cobalt, neodymium, samarium and dysprosium as subcomponents, and calcining the mixture at a temperature of from about 1150.degree. to about 1400.degree. C.
